随着互联网的发展,动态网站已经成为了企业、组织和个人展示自我、提供服务的重要手段,动态网站不仅提供了丰富的信息和交互功能,还能根据用户行为和需求进行个性化展示和响应,本文将详细介绍动态网站的制作与设计,帮助读者了解如何构建一个功能强大、用户体验良好的动态网站。
动态网站的制作
动态网站的制作涉及到前端和后端的开发,前端开发主要负责网站的界面设计和交互效果,而后端开发则负责处理数据、提供API接口以及与数据库交互。
1、前端开发
前端开发可以使用各种前端框架和库,如React、Vue和Angular等,这些框架和库提供了丰富的组件和工具,能够帮助开发者快速构建出功能强大的动态网站,前端开发还需要考虑到用户体验,如响应式设计、加载速度、兼容性等问题。
2、后端开发
后端开发通常使用Node.js、Python、Java等后端语言,使用数据库如MySQL、MongoDB等存储数据,后端开发需要处理大量的数据请求,提供高效的数据查询和API接口,同时还需要考虑到安全性、可扩展性和稳定性等问题。
动态网站的设计
动态网站的设计涉及到用户体验、交互设计、信息架构和布局设计等方面,一个优秀的动态网站应该具备清晰的用户界面、良好的交互体验和合理的信息架构,能够吸引用户并引导他们完成目标任务。
1、用户体验
用户体验是动态网站设计的核心,需要考虑的因素包括网站的响应速度、加载时间、兼容性、布局和色彩搭配等,一个优秀的动态网站应该能够提供流畅的用户体验,让用户感到舒适和愉悦。
2、交互设计
交互设计是动态网站的重要组成部分,需要考虑的因素包括按钮、链接、表单等交互元素的布局和交互效果,一个优秀的动态网站应该能够提供良好的交互体验,让用户能够方便地浏览和操作网站内容。
3、信息架构
信息架构是动态网站的核心内容,需要考虑的因素包括信息的组织方式、分类体系和导航设计等,一个优秀的动态网站应该能够提供清晰的信息架构,让用户能够方便地获取所需信息。
动态网站的制作与设计涉及到前端开发、后端开发、用户体验和交互设计等多个方面,只有综合考虑这些因素,才能构建出一个功能强大、用户体验良好的动态网站。